Colorer case excel fonction résultat calcul hexa 000000 à FFFFFF

Achelemix Messages postés 4 Date d'inscription   Statut Membre Dernière intervention   -  
TheSavior2017 Messages postés 1 Date d'inscription   Statut Membre Dernière intervention   -
bonjour
Je souhaite coloré une case excel en fonction d'une valeur donnée en code hexadécimal entre 000000 et FFFFFF.
donc pouvoir utiliser toutes les couleurs de façon non manuelle.

par exemple #BD56A0
hexadécimal décimal en RVB
BD56A0 12408480 213 106 72
et on obtient une sorte de rouge qui tire sur le marron.
mais je voudrais que la cellule prenne la couleur directement à partir de la valeur que j'aurai mise ou calculée. ne pas être obligé de le faire manuellement.
la fonction qui colore en fonction d'une valeur n’utilise pas toute la palette des couleurs, que 2 ou 3 couleurs avec leurs nuance intermédiaires.
Je veux pouvoir mettre n importe quelle couleur de la palette.
merci
A voir également:

1 réponse

c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729
 
Bonjour,

Voir ceci en vba avec un classeur à télécharger:

https://silkyroad.developpez.com/VBA/ConversionCodesCouleurs/

après avoir pris connaissance de ce site, voici le code pour colorer une cellule:

 Range("A1").Interior.Color = &HF378E0 'Valeur Hex




@+ Le Pivert
1
TheSavior2017 Messages postés 1 Date d'inscription   Statut Membre Dernière intervention  
 
hello,
je sais que ce n'est pas exactement ca mais peut-être en bidouillant un peu la manip', tu peux réussir a faire ce que tu cherches ?

https://www.ablebits.com/office-addins-blog/2013/10/18/change-background-color-excel-based-on-cell-value/

en VBA tu as ce script aussi :

https://stackoverflow.com/questions/10455366/how-to-highlight-a-cell-using-the-hex-color-value-within-the-cell

#bd56a0 correspond plutôt à du violet non ?

https://www.crazy-colors.net/en/hex/bd56a0

tiens nous au courant! :)
0